WebJan 12, 2024 · The first cholera outbreak in Haiti was reported in October 2010, 10 months after the catastrophic earthquake that killed >200,000 persons and displaced >1 million. The 2010 outbreak resulted in >820,000 cases and approximately 10,000 deaths ( 1, 2 ). Nearly 12 years after the outbreak began, Haiti was declared cholera-free on February 4, 2024 ... WebApr 4, 2024 · The cholera pandemic to which Valingot refers is the seventh, as documented by epidemiologists. Driven almost exclusively by the Vibrio cholerae biotype El Tor, serogroup O1, the pandemic started in 1961 and tailed off in 1975. WebCholera was first reported in Haiti in October 2010. Nationally, a total of 820 000 cases of cholera including 9792 deaths were reported between October 2010 and February 2024. The last confirmed case in this outbreak was reported in January 2024 in I’Estère in the Artibonite department of Haiti.
